Blizny [ˈbliznɨ] is a village in the administrative district of Gmina Przywidz, within Gdańsk County, Pomeranian Voivodeship, in northern Poland.[1] It lies approximately 4 kilometres (2 mi) south-east of Przywidz, 21 km (13 mi) south-west of Pruszcz Gdański, and 28 km (17 mi) south-west of the regional capital Gdańsk.
